Occupational Therapist (OT) Piedmont Post Acute - Piedmont, SC $40-$50/hour | PRN Opportunities About Us Piedmont Post Acute is an 88-bed skilled nursing facility located in Piedmont, South Carolina—just 20 minutes from Greenville. Our smaller size creates a quiet, close-knit, family-oriented environment where we truly value our residents and staff. We are seeking a dedicated Occupational Therapist (OT) to join our rehab team and help residents regain independence and improve their quality of life.
What We Offer Competitive pay:
$40-$50/hour Flexible scheduling options : Full-time, part-time, and PRN opportunities available Consistent part-time hours PRN opportunities across our Upstate network Employee appreciation events throughout the year Career advancement opportunities within our South Carolina network Supportive, team-oriented therapy environment Position Summary As an Occupational Therapist (OT) , you will evaluate and treat residents to improve their ability to perform daily activities, restore function, and promote independence. You will collaborate with an interdisciplinary team to deliver individualized, patient-centered care. Key Responsibilities Perform patient evaluations and develop individualized treatment plans Provide therapy services to improve ADLs, strength, coordination, and mobility Monitor patient progress and adjust treatment plans as needed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ation Collaborate with physicians, families, and care team members Participate in care plan meetings and discharge planning Conduct staff education and in-service training Qualifications Degree in Occupational Therapy (Bachelor's required; Master's or Doctorate preferred) Active, unencumbered OT license in South Carolina (required) Experience in a long-term care or rehab setting preferred Familiarity with PointClickCare (PCC) and Casamba preferred Strong clinical, communication, and organizational skills Commitment to ongoing education and professional development Why Join Piedmont Post Acute?
